Dil Raju is a successful producer and a fortunate filmmaker in many respects. Recent developments surrounding the release of Bharateeyadudu 2 affirm that Dil Raju has been fortunate enough to avoid the film’s potential failure.
Initially, director Shankar had planned to collaborate with Dil Raju on this film. They even signed an official agreement, but due to delays and Shankar’s high budget, Dil Raju decided to withdraw.
Subsequently, Shankar proposed another project titled ‘Game Changer’ to Dil Raju. This film, featuring Ram Charan, indeed became a game-changer for Dil Raju.
Despite facing delays, Dil Raju is not solely responsible for the costs; Zee Company is also involved. The anticipation and hype surrounding ‘Game Changer’ far surpass those of Bharateeyudu 2.
Ram Charan’s enhanced status post-RRR has created a significant market in the North, and the film is expected to generate substantial business in the Telugu states. This level of success is something Bharateeyudu 2 has not achieved to the same extent.
Looking back, missing out on Bharateeyadu 2 and acquiring ‘Game Changer’ appears to have been highly advantageous for Dil Raju.
The Shankar brand also holds considerable value in Tamil Nadu. While rumors suggest a December release, Shankar has emphasized that a release date will not be confirmed until final editing is complete.
